MATLAB期末考试试卷

MATLAB期末考试试卷

ID:83338237

大小:1.05 MB

页数:13页

时间:2023-04-14

上传者:灯火阑珊2019
MATLAB期末考试试卷_第1页
MATLAB期末考试试卷_第2页
MATLAB期末考试试卷_第3页
MATLAB期末考试试卷_第4页
MATLAB期末考试试卷_第5页
MATLAB期末考试试卷_第6页
MATLAB期末考试试卷_第7页
MATLAB期末考试试卷_第8页
MATLAB期末考试试卷_第9页
MATLAB期末考试试卷_第10页
资源描述:

《MATLAB期末考试试卷》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

MATLABὃᔁᐸὃᫀஹ⚪1ஹMATLABᵨ☢ᒹ_ஹஹஹ_ஹᑁᦪᘤஹMᦻ/ᘤஹ!/"#ᘤஹ$%&஺2ஹMATLAB(Infᡈinf⊤,_ஹNaNᡈnan⊤,_ஹnargout⊤,_஺3ஹMATLAB(⌹./⌕ᵨ1ᵨ2ᐭ452ᐭ46Ḅᑖ◞:;4ஹ"#ᘤ/⌕ᵨ<ᑁ=4Ḅ_ஹ_>஺5ஹMATLAB?@AᐰC᪗EᣚGᓫC᪗ḄᢣJG_ஹKᓫC᪗ᣚLMᐰC᪗ḄᢣJG6ஹNOᦪḄ᪗Pᨵ_ஹ_ஹ“S1”᪗P஺NஹTU⚪1ஹTVMATLABᔊXᢣJḄ/⌕ᵨ஺2ஹTVᦪḄYᵨ஺3ஹTVMATLABZᦪḄ[\]᪀஺4ஹTV_ᑴNO$%Ḅabc஺dஹ▅fghijUk⚪(m⚪4ᑖnᐳ28ᑖ)1ஹᑏMCᑡᢣJst]u஺A=zeros(2,4);A(:)=l:8;s=[235];A(s)Sa=[102030]'

1A(s)=Sa2ஹᑏMCᑡᢣJst]u஺A=reshape(l:16,2,8)reshape(A,4,4)s=[l3689111416];A(s)=O3ஹᑏMCᑡᢣJst]u஺A=[l,2;3,4];B=[-l,-2;2;l];S=3;A.*BA*BS.*AS*B4ஹC☢ḄZᦪ/⌕vᡂxyYz?functionf=factor(n)ifn<=l41;elsef=factor(n-l)*n;

2end5ஹᑏMCᑡᢣJst]u஺ch="ABcl23d4e56Fg9,;subch=ch(l:5)revch=ch(end:-l:l)k=find(ch>=4an&ch<=6z');ch(k)=ch(k)-Ca'-A');char(ch)6ஹᑏMCᑡᢣJst]u஺A(1,1)={'thisiscell');A{1,2}={[123;456]};A{2,l}=[l+2*i];A{2,2}=A{1,2}{1}+(A{1,2}{1}(1,1)+A{1,2}{1}(2,2));celldisp(A)7ஹC☢ḄghvᡂYz|xy}t=0:pi/50:4*pi;yO=exp(-t/3);y=exp(-t/3).*sin(3*t);plot(t,y;-r,,t,yO;:b;t,-yO;:b,)xlabel(u\bf\itt');

3ylabelC\bf\ity';gridon;~ஹg⚪32ᑖ1ஹ1ஹᙠ$ᑖᵨ⁐?>⁐_ᑴyl=sinx>y2=cosxᙠ0,4*piḄniᵨ.*᪗MᩩḄ$஺5ᑖ2ஹᑖᙠ$%Ḅ$_ᑴy=sintsin9t>y=sintsin9tᐸᒹ஺4ᑖ3ஹᖪᡠ¢£Ḅᖪ¤?tᡭᢚ├¨n᪗©᝞Cᖪ¤«¬ᵨpriceᩭ⊤,®price<200¯ᨵᢚᡷ200fফ=2Zᦪ஺6ᑖ5ஹᑏµ¶·ᡂ¸¹ᳮḄgh12ᑖA.᪀⌼µ¶·]᪀nᒹ¶·Ḅ¶.n¼½n¾g½¿▲ÁÂnὃᡂ¸>ÄᙳÆ&Ç;4ᑖB.ÈÉÊnËÌ2ᐭNµ¶·ḄÍÎnᑖAÏж·ḄÍÎᐭᑮÒÓḄÇnÔÇ(¯ᨵÆᓽGᡈ0iÖLÄᙳᡂ¸ᑏᐭᑮÄᙳÆÇ஺4ᑖC.᪷KÄᙳÆ᣸hni2M¶·Ḅ¼½ஹ¶.>Äᙳᡂ¸஺4ᑖ

4ὃᫀஹ⚪1ᑖ20ᑖ1ஹMATLABᵨ☢ᒹÚJஹ"#ᘤஹÚJᔊXஹÛÜÝÞஹᑁᦪᘤஹMᦻ/ᘤஹ!/"#ᘤஹ$%&஺2^MATLABInfᡈinf⊤,ßàᜧஹNaNᡈnan⊤,|µᦪஹnargout⊤,Zᦪ2Mâ4ᦪÝ஺3ஹMATLAB(⌹./⌕ᵨ⌕ã,ÖL]uḄᢣJ5ᐸäᢣJḄᑖ◞;ᵨ2ᐭ452ᐭ46Ḅᑖ◞:;ᵨᦪᐗæᑖ◞:.஺4ஹ"#ᘤ/⌕ᵨ<ᑁ=4Ḅç▅ஹè>஺5ஹMATLAB?@AᐰC᪗EᣚGᓫC᪗ḄᢣJGSub2indஹKᓫC᪗ᣚLMᐰC᪗ḄᢣJGInd2subo6ஹNOᦪḄ᪗Pᨵ“ᐰC᪗”᪗Pஹ“ᓫC᪗”᪗Pஹ“S1”᪗P஺7ஹᙠµᐗêᦪA(ëìí2tí3ᑡᐗêᐗæᵨA2,3;ëìᦪí2tí3ᑡᐗê(ḄᑁîᵨA{2,3}஺8ஹMATLAB(elfᵨ<ï◀$%ஹclcᵨ<ï◀ᢣJ(ã,ᑁîஹclearᵨ<ï◀MATLAB(èḄ=4஺ஹ⚪⚪5ᑖᐳ20ᑖ1.TVMATLABᔊXᢣJḄ/⌕ᵨ஺ᔊXᢣJñÞḼᵨᡝᙠMATLABᢣJ(ᡠ2ᐭôḄᡠᨵᢣJ஺ᔊXñÞᒹ®mõö÷MATLABḄønmõö÷MATLABäᙠᢣJ(stôḄᡠᨵᢣJ஺ÓᵨYzᨵᓫtᡈùtᢣJḄúᑴ>stஹ·ᡂMᦻ&஺2ஹTVᦪḄYᵨ஺“”ᦪḄYᵨ®ᙠ¯ᨵ“”ᦪû5ḄsLønÖL]u(Ḅ“”üᔠᳮᙢÿ“ᡠḄ”ᵨ“”ᦪᐸᦪᦋᦪḄᜧᦋᦪḄᦪ஺

53ஹ$%MATLAB&ᦪḄ'(᪀஺ᐺ+M&ᦪᦻ-Ḅ᪀.&ᦪᵭ0(2)4(Functiondeclarationline)ஹHl4(Thefirsthelptextline)ஹᙠ678ᦻ((Helptext)9ஹ:ᑏ<=ᦋ>?ஹ&ᦪ@(Functionbody)஺4ஹ$%AᑴCDEḄFGHI஺AᑴCDEḄFGHIJ.K6ᦪLMᜓஹ⌱2DEPQRDSTஹUᵨCK6ADᢣWஹXTYḄ[ஹᙶ᪗ᑖ_6ஹDE`ஹDEḄabcd஺eஹ▅ghijklm⚪(o⚪4ᑖᐳ28ᑖ)1ஹᑏqrᑡᢣW4஺A=zeros(2,4);A(:)=1:8;s=[235];A(s)Sa=[102030]1A(s)=Saans=235Sa=102030A=120307104682ஹᑏqrᑡᢣW4஺A=reshape(1:16,2,8)

6A13579111315246810121416reshape(A,4,4)ans=15913261014371115481216s=[13689111416];A(s)=0A=005700131524001012003ஹᑏqrᑡᢣW4஺A=[l,2;3,4];B=[-l,-2;2,l];S=3;A.*BA*BS.*AS*B

7ans-1-464ans=305-2ans=36912ans=-3-6634ஹr☢Ḅ&ᦪu⌕wᡂyz{?functionf=factor(n)ifn<=lf=lelsef=factor(n-l)*n;endᑭᵨ&ᦪḄ⌴Uᵨn!஺5ஹᑏqrᑡᢣW4஺ch=tABc123d4e56Fg9';subch=ch(l:5)revch=ch(end:-l:l)k=find(ch>=ta,&ch<=6z,);ch(k)=ch(k)-Ca,-tA,);char(ch)

8length(k)subch=ABcl2revch=9gF65e4d321cBAans=ABC123D4E56FG96ஹᑏqrᑡᢣW4஺A(1,1)={'thisiscell'}A{1,2}={[123;456]};A{2,l}=[l+2*i];A{2,2}=A{1,2}{1}+(A{1,2}{1}(1,1)+A{1,2}{1}(2,2));celldisp(A)A{151}=thisiscellA{251}=1.0000+2.0000iA{1,2}{1}=123456A{2,2}=7891011127ஹᙠ®F¯D°Aᑴ±¯&ᦪ²±¯&ᦪᑖ³´:y=e(-t/3)y0=e(""*sin(3t)ᐸ°y´ᵨº⁐Ḅb¼6½y0´ᵨᐲ⁐Ḅ¿6AᑴtḄ9À´Á0:4ᐔÃ,

9tḄHÄJᐔ/50,tY

10case{0,1}%Ô_Ö200rate=0;case(2,3,4}%Ô_ᜧÖ×Ö200Ö500rate=3/100;casenum2cell(5:9)%Ô_ᜧÖ×Ö500Ö1000rate=5/100;casenum2cell(10:24)%Ô_ᜧÖ×Ö1000Ö2500rate=8/100;casenum2cell(25:49)%Ô_ᜧÖ×Ö2500Ö5000rate=10/100;otherwise%Ô_ᜧÖ×Ö5000rate=14/100;endprice=price*(l-rate)%ÐqᖪÓ¼▭├ÚÔ_4ஹlᫀfunctionf=fab(n)if(n==1)f=1elseif(n=2)f=2;eIsef=fab(n-1)+fab(n-2);end5ஹlᫀstr1='';str2='';str3=

11val=celI(5,2)azeros(5,1);ave=0;student=struct('Name',str1,'No',str2,1Scores1,vaI,,Ave',ave);n=input(*pIeaseinputstudentsnumber:');fori=1:nstr1=input(fName:1);str2=input('No.:');%fork=1:2%vaI(k,:)input('CurricuIumsandScores:;%a(k,1)=val{k,2};%end%vaI(1,:)=inputCCurriculum:*);%vaI(:,2)=input(*Scores:1);vaI=input(fpIeaseinputfiveCurriculumsandScores:');fork=1:5a(k,1)=val{k,2};endstudent(i).Name=str1;student(i).No=str2;student(i).Scores=val;student(i).Ave=mean(a);endforii=1:(1ength(student)-1)iptr=ii;forjj=ii+1:Iength(student)

12if(student(jj).Ave>student(iptr).Ave)iptr=jj;endendifii~=iptrtemp=student(ii);student(ii)student(iptr);student(iptr)=temp;endendforii=1:length(student)ifstudent(ii).Ave>80disp(student(ii).Name);disp(student(ii).Ave);endenddisp(['studentname*,bIanks(6),'studentno.',bIanks(6),'studentaverage']);disp('')forii=1:Iength(student)disp([student(ii).Name,bIanks(20),student(ii).No,blanks(20),num2str(student(ii).Ave)]);end

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。
最近更新
更多
大家都在看
近期热门
关闭